CREATETHEATER and SUNY CORTLAND PERFORMING ARTS Announce New Professional College Musical Theatre Partnership

CreateTheater's Executive Producer Cate Cammarata and Kevin Halpin, Chair of SUNY Cortland's Musical Theater Department, have announced a new College Musical Theater Partnership in order to develop new musicals in Cortland's professional-oriented B.F.A. program.

The new CreateTheater/SUNY Cortland partnership will begin accepting submissions of new musicals from now until July 17th, 2022. To submit, go to https://createtheater.com/college-theater-development-partnership/

Cammarata, an Off-Broadway producer and founder of CreateTheater, and Halpin, Chair of the Performing Arts Department at SUNY Cortland, went to college together and majored in theater years ago at Syracuse University Drama. "I can't say enough about the B.F.A. in Musical Theatre program Kevin created at Cortland," she said. "It is truly one of the best professional programs I've seen. This Musical Development Partnership will give students a chance to understand how professional work is developed and give musical theater teams a professional residency to hear their work performed by a talented and engaged student body."

The new program will produce one staged reading each year, with submissions managed by CreateTheater and the final project selected by the college faculty. It is seeking new musicals in development with no previous production history, centered around young people's voices and perspectives about current issues.

"I am so happy to be working with my long-time friend and colleague, Cate Cammarata, to start this exciting program," said Halpin. "This is an exceptional opportunity for our students to be involved in the creation of a musical as active participants at the beginning of the process. I am also thrilled to be able to provide the opportunity for new work and new voices to begin their journey. Musical theatre, and the development of young performers, has comprised the bulk of my life's work. Although we have had isolated opportunities to bring new musicals to life in the past, this focused program is both a great step forward for our program and a personal dream realized."

KEVIN T. HALPIN has worked for over 40 years as a performer, director and choreographer across the US and internationally. Throughout his career he has directed and choreographed over 100 productions. In 1999 he moved to Cortland, NY to establish and develop the Musical Theatre Program at SUNY Cortland. The new BFA program is focused on providing every young artist the opportunity to reach their full potential in all aspects of musical theatre performance.

Cate Cammarata is an Off-Broadway producer, director, and dramaturg in NYC, dedicated to the development of new plays and musicals. She is the Founder and Executive Producer of CreateTheater's New Works Festival. Off-Broadway: The Assignment, My Father's Daughter. Regional: My Life Is a Musical (Bay Street Theater), Bran Castle (Porchlight Theater, Chicago). Cate is an Associate Professor of Theatre Arts at CUNY Baruch College and has an MFA in Dramaturgy from SUNY Stony Brook. Her company, CreateTheater, has been helping writers develop and produce their work since the company was launched in 2016.
